#7e1c44 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7e1c44 is composed of 49.4% red, 11% green and 26.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 77.8% magenta, 46% yellow and 50.6% black. It has a hue angle of 335.5 degrees, a saturation of 63.6% and a lightness of 30.2%. #7e1c44 color hex could be obtained by blending #fc3888 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

#7e1c44 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7e1c44 has RGB values of R:126, G:28, B:68 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.78, Y:0.46,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 8264772.

Shades and Tints of #7e1c44
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0307 is the darkest color, while #fefd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#7e1c44
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4f4b4d is the less saturated color, while #960440 is the most saturated one.
